| NEW Realization 1 | ||
|---|---|---|
| type | Polysemy | |
| language | Ancient Greek | |
| lexeme | ἕσπερος | |
| meaning 1 | evening | |
| direction | → | |
| meaning 2 | the evening star, Venus | |
| reference | LSJ | |
| comment | shortened form of ἕσπερος ἀστήρ |
|

| NEW Realization 3 | ||
|---|---|---|
| type | Derivation | |
| language | Old English | |
| lexeme 1 | ǣfen + steorra | |
| lexeme 2 | ǣfensteorra | |
| meaning 1 | evening + star | |
| direction | → | |
| meaning 2 | the evening star, i.e. Venus as seen in the early evening | Sēo niht hæfþ seofon dǣlas […] Ōðer is wesperum, þæt is ǣfen, þonne sē ǣfensteorra betweox þǣre repsunge ætīewþ Bede, Leechdoms, III, 242 The night has seven parts […] Second is vesperum (i.e., evening), when the evening star appears amid the interval […] |
| reference | Bosworth, Toller | |
| comment | Middle English: euensterre |
|
